The feature that most distinguishes topographic maps from maps of other types is the use of contour lines to portray the shape and elevation of the land. Topographic maps render the three-dimensional ups and downs of the terrain on a two-dimensional surface.
What is unique about topographic maps?
The distinctive characteristic of a topographic map is the use of elevation contour lines to show the shape of the Earth’s surface. USGS topographic maps also show many other kinds of geographic features including roads, railroads, rivers, streams, lakes, boundaries, place or feature names, mountains, and much more.
How do you do a topographic map?
Use contour lines to determine elevations of mountains and flat areas. The closer together the lines are, the steeper the slope. Contour elevation numbers indicate the direction of elevation by always reading (pointing) uphill.

What are the 6 colors on a map?

- U.S. Geological Survey (USGS) topo- graphic maps are printed using up to six colors (black, blue, green, red, brown, and purple).
- It is possible to order a separate, full- scale film negative or positive that shows in black and white all the features printed in a given color on a particular map.
What do topographic maps tell us?
Topographic maps conventionally show topography, or land contours, by means of contour lines. Contour lines are curves that connect contiguous points of the same altitude (isohypse). In other words, every point on the marked line of 100 m elevation is 100 m above mean sea level.

How are topographic maps different from reference maps?
Like General Reference Maps, Topographic Maps are a summary of the landscape and show important physical (natural and man-made) features in an area. The primary difference is that they show elevation in detail. they show elevation using contour lines. Put simply, a contour line is a line which joins points of equal elevation above sea level

How are two contour lines separated on a topographic map?
Two contour lines next to one another are separated by a constant difference in elevation (such as 20 ft or 100 ft). This difference between contour lines is called the contour interval. The map legend gives the contour interval.
